大同到香港物流>電源/新能源>電源設計應用> > 正文

使用PIC16F1885x CIP設計可通訊調光的大功率植物補光金滷燈電子鎮流器

2021年01月18日 14:28 次閲讀

1.系統結構

數字化鎮流器硬件組成包括EMI濾波電路、整流及功率因數校正電路、高頻逆變器、LCC串並聯諧振電路和以單片機為核心的數字控制電路。

o4YBAGAFK3yAMKYdAACukzve3yg584.png

圖1-1系統框圖

2.有源功率因數校正電路

3.橋式逆變電路和負載諧振電路

大功率金屬鹵化物燈工作於高頻的交流狀態,這就需要一個電路將前級功率因數校正電路環節得到的直流電壓轉換成高頻的交流電壓,因此,橋式逆變電路是電子鎮流器電路中最基本同時也是最關鍵的組成部分。

圖3-3串並聯負載諧振變換電路

全橋LCC串並聯諧振電路如圖3-3(a)所示,串並聯諧振具有帶通特性,能有效衰減方波VAB的高次諧波分量,串聯電容Cs能夠濾除電源電壓中的直流分量。

o4YBAGAFK6uAbGFFAAIzOoiuUUw228.png

圖3-4全橋工作模態

大功率金屬鹵化物燈工作於高頻的交流狀態,為保證燈的壽命和有效工作,金屬鹵化物燈的兩個電極應該交替工作,以避免其中一個電極的過渡消耗。所以兩個電極工作的時間應該保持一致,並且在燈電流中不能存在直流成分。基於以上這些要求,本文所研究的數字化大功率金屬鹵化物燈電子鎮流器後級採用了全橋逆變LCC串並聯諧振電路的設計。基本的全橋逆變電路如圖3-4所示,本設計中,LCC諧振變換器的一個工作週期裏,上下半橋的驅動信號的佔空比應該儘可能相同,而且為了避免電流過零時可能出現的熄弧現象,驅動信號的佔空比應該接近50%。假定LCC諧振變換器中所有的器件都工作在理想狀態,在全橋逆變LCC諧振電路的一個高頻工作週期中,共有四種工作模態如圖3-4所示。首先Q1、Q4導通,Q2、Q3關斷,諧振網絡和金屬鹵化物燈由電源母線提供能量。在半個工作週期結束後,電感通過Q2、Q3的寄生體二極管續流,然後Q2、Q3導通,Q1、Q4關斷,諧振網絡和金屬鹵化物燈再由電源母線提供能量,電感通過Q1、Q4的寄生體二極管續流。

4.啓動方式

基於LCC串並聯負載諧振電路的啓動方式,可以大幅降低啓動電壓,延長燈泡使用壽命。結合LCC諧振網絡的電壓傳輸特性,可以採取一種滑頻軟啓動方法。全橋逆變器的工作頻率逐漸靠近LCC網絡的固有諧振點時,施加在金滷燈兩端的電壓隨着頻率的推移逐漸增加。這種方法可以有效降低啓動電壓對燈極的衝擊,延長燈泡壽命。

如圖4-2所示,滑頻軟啓動過程具體為:工作頻率從工作點(1)逐漸向工作點(2)滑動,燈啓動後燈電阻從無窮大變到近似短路(3),檢測電路判斷燈亮後,直接過渡到工作點(4)。需要注意的是,當頻率到達ωr(off),而燈沒亮的時候,施加到燈兩端的電壓是非常大的,而這個電壓僅通過電感和電容的等效串聯電阻來限制,所以可能會導致不安全的情況發生。所以,在具體應用的時候,需要確定一個電壓限幅和一個頻率的最小值,以保證電路的安全。

o4YBAGAFK_KAALxdAACs9qqHyAk868.png

從圖4-3中可以看出,金滷燈點亮之前,燈端電壓逐漸升高,電流基本為零,近似於燈端開路的情況,燈點亮之後,燈電壓迅速減小,而燈電流則迅速增大,近似於突然短路。

5.控制策略

啓動之後,金滷燈還要經歷從啓動到穩態的預熱階段,最終達到穩態。根據大功率金滷燈自身的電氣特性,將金滷燈點亮以後的工作過程分為三個階段,分別為:恆頻控制階段,過渡階段和穩態工作階段,如圖5-1所示。

pIYBAGAFLCGAQiw1AAKq3kcGRRs137.png

圖5-1大功率金滷燈分段控制策略

6.輔助控制電源

輔助電源在功率因數校正電路中提供+12V的直流工作電源,在全橋逆變器的驅動電路中,需要給單片機提供+5V的直流工作電源。本文采用UC3844和外圍元器件組成降壓電路來提供鎮流器所需的+12V輔助電源,並通過線性穩壓器MCP1703A轉換為+5V電源為全橋逆變器的控制電路提供電源。

7.通訊調光電路

通訊採用485總線,MODBUS通訊協議,通過調節全橋電路頻率來改變輸出功率,達到調光效果,通過不同的光譜針對植物的不同作用,找到調節點,繼而達到不同植物或不同時間段的補光效果。485通訊採用常規RS485接口芯片,MOSBUS協議包含CRC校驗,運行穩定可靠,可實現遠端PC機針對多組金滷燈植物補光燈的控制調節。

8.軟件設計

1、程序流程圖:

圖8-1主程序流程圖圖8-5485_MODBUS通訊調光子函數流程圖

2、通過MicrochipPIC16F18854CIP外設NCO+CWG輸出互補方波,ADC針對直流母線及負載燈管電流電壓採集,實現針對全橋變頻電路的閉環功率輸出控制。

CIP(CoreIndependentPeripherals,獨立於內核的外圍設備)

為什麼使用CIP?:減少CPU開銷、硬件級執行速度、可從CPU卸載程序任務、釋放CPU以集中處理應用算法、降低功耗、CPU可以更低的速度運行、CPU有時可進入休眠模式、降低系統硬件的複雜性。

1、NCO(NumericallyControlledOscillator,數控振盪器)新硬件模塊是一個定時器,該定時器在所選的輸入時鐘源作用下以一個16位的固定遞增值向一個20位的累加器進行遞增,引起累加器週期性上溢,來對輸入時鐘源進行分頻。NCO具有真正的線性頻率控制能力。

2、CWG(ComplementaryWaveformGenerator,互補波形發生器)新硬件模塊,從選擇的一個輸入源生成一個兩路輸出帶死區延時和自動關斷功能的互補波形。CWG模塊具有時鐘源選擇、產生互補輸出波形的輸入源選擇、輸出使能和極性控制、上升和下降沿死區控制、自動關斷/重啓控制等特性。

圖8-6控制方式圖

pIYBAGAFLQiAKwANAACoT_hRNiE305.png

pIYBAGAFLROAOOb_AAJ7wa0_P_w106.png

MicrochipMPLABXIDEMCC配置NCO+CWG方式,採用兩組CWG,控制兩隻金滷燈,4路ADC通道採集,採集直流主電源電壓電流、變頻諧振電路電壓電流。配置好後通過Generate生成C語言代碼,再針對其他控制程序編程。

作者:Tyler.Wang

下載發燒友APP

打造屬於您的人脈電子圈

關注大同到香港物流微信

有趣有料的資訊及技術乾貨

關注發燒友課堂

鎖定最新課程活動及技術直播

大同到香港物流觀察

一線報道 · 深度觀察 · 最新資訊
收藏 人收藏
分享:

評論

相關推薦

書童哥(龍順宇)62講生動課程帶您玩兒轉STM8單片機

【大同到香港物流】:朋友們大家好,本套視頻教程由本人錄製,現做為錄播課程上傳至大同到香港物流平台,感謝大同到香港物流讓單片機學習的
發燒友學院發表於 2019-01-19 00:00 3035次閲讀
書童哥(龍順宇)62講生動課程帶您玩兒轉STM8單片機

基於賽元微單片機及易微聯模塊設計的四路智能排插設...

電路説明: 1.由於是初版,所以電路圖就畫的相對比較隨意,不過還是可以用的。 2.電源採用KP311....
發表於 2021-01-18 18:12 17次閲讀
基於賽元微單片機及易微聯模塊設計的四路智能排插設...

51單片機驅動帶fifo的ov7670模塊

我用stc89c52驅動帶fifo的ov7670模塊,做彩條測試的時候出現了異常,有大佬能解答部分一下嗎。問題出在了哪個環節呢?...
發表於 2021-01-18 17:47 5次閲讀
51單片機驅動帶fifo的ov7670模塊

組串式逆變器和集中式逆變器相比的優勢

  近些年來我國光伏產業發展迅猛,2018光伏裝機量超過43GW。逆變器作為光伏系統的高度智能單元,是光伏發電系統中...
發表於 2021-01-18 17:13 0次閲讀
組串式逆變器和集中式逆變器相比的優勢

三極管在數字電路里的開關特性

當 IO 口輸出高電平 5V 時,三極管導通,OUT 輸出低電平 0V,當 IO 口輸出低電平時,三....
發表於 2021-01-18 16:37 53次閲讀
三極管在數字電路里的開關特性

全局變量簡直就是嵌入式系統的戈蘭高地

要成為一個資深的嵌入式工程師相當難,一方面要有非常紮實的理論知識,同時也要有相當的那種大型的、高頻C....
發表於 2021-01-18 16:26 31次閲讀
全局變量簡直就是嵌入式系統的戈蘭高地

單片機電子時鐘誤差原因分析

單片機電子時鐘利用內部定時,計數器溢出產生中斷(12MHz晶振一般為50ms)再乘以相應的倍率,來實....
發表於 2021-01-18 16:18 45次閲讀
單片機電子時鐘誤差原因分析

【大同到香港物流】2020年度top10榜單——單片機/MCU論壇問答

本榜單彙總了2020年回覆數最多的提問帖,看看是否也是你在學習路上經常遇到的難題,每個帖子都有推薦理由,希望這個榜...
發表於 2021-01-18 14:37 9次閲讀
【大同到香港物流】2020年度top10榜單——單片機/MCU論壇問答

基於DSP TMS320F240微處理器實現車牀...

在我國,經濟型車牀因其價廉而得到廣泛的應用。在數控化改造過程中,常使用的是單片機系統,如MCS-51....
發表於 2021-01-18 10:36 71次閲讀
基於DSP TMS320F240微處理器實現車牀...

基於89C52單片機和PDIUSBD12芯片實現...

嵌入式系統(Embedded Systems)被定義為以應用為中心,以計算機技術為基礎,軟件硬件可裁....
發表於 2021-01-18 10:12 135次閲讀
基於89C52單片機和PDIUSBD12芯片實現...

基於MCS-51單片機應用電路的抗干擾設計

嵌入式控制系統是為了實現某型軍用船艇模擬訓練系統的操縱控制功能而開發的。該系統基於軍民兩用的自動技術....
發表於 2021-01-18 09:53 158次閲讀
基於MCS-51單片機應用電路的抗干擾設計

過壓電路保護元器件詳解,一文就看明白了

電子電路的精密元器件很容易在過壓、過流、浪湧等情況時損壞。隨着技術的發展,電子電路的產品日益多樣化和複雜化,...
發表於 2021-01-18 09:42 0次閲讀
過壓電路保護元器件詳解,一文就看明白了

MS8005參數特性介紹 通用8051 Core...

MS8005 是通用型 1T 8051 Core MCU。在同樣的系統時鐘下,比傳統的 8051 運....
發表於 2021-01-18 09:12 23次閲讀
MS8005參數特性介紹 通用8051 Core...

各種單片機常見的延時與中斷問題及解決方法

[td] 延時與中斷出錯,是新手在單片機開發應用過程中,經常會遇到的問題,本文彙總整理了包含了MCS-51系列單片機、...
發表於 2021-01-18 06:12 0次閲讀
各種單片機常見的延時與中斷問題及解決方法

OI53131A高精度通用計數器的功能特點及應用...

OI53131A型高精度通用計數器是一款高精度測頻測時儀器。它測頻分頻率達到10位/秒,測時單次分辨....
發表於 2021-01-17 10:13 209次閲讀
OI53131A高精度通用計數器的功能特點及應用...

如何使用IGBT模塊把電機驅動裝置和逆變器設計進...

電機和逆變器的使用在工業自動化、機器人、電動汽車、太陽能、白色家電和電動工具等應用中持續增長。伴隨着....
發表於 2021-01-15 17:06 143次閲讀
如何使用IGBT模塊把電機驅動裝置和逆變器設計進...

一個秒懂的電路理解方式

  初戀的男人的心就像個最簡單的信號放大器,女人控制着輸入端。你一個最微小的快樂信號都能給他帶來極大....
發表於 2021-01-15 16:26 287次閲讀
一個秒懂的電路理解方式

特斯拉正式推出自研太陽能逆變器:基於 Power...

1月15日消息 據外媒 electrek 報道,自 2016 年收購 SolarCity 以來,特斯....
發表於 2021-01-15 15:36 314次閲讀
特斯拉正式推出自研太陽能逆變器:基於 Power...

單片機硬件設計原則:抗干擾常用的幾個方法

1 在元器件的佈局方面,應該把相互有關的元件儘量放得靠近一些,例如,時鐘發生器、晶振、CPU的時鐘輸....
發表於 2021-01-15 15:08 167次閲讀
單片機硬件設計原則:抗干擾常用的幾個方法

【大同到香港物流】2020年度top10榜單——單片機/MCU論壇資料

本榜單彙總了2020年下載量最高的10份資料,每份資料都有推薦理由,總有一款你喜歡的,快來看看吧! 1、 作者:As我...
發表於 2021-01-15 14:51 427次閲讀
【大同到香港物流】2020年度top10榜單——單片機/MCU論壇資料

單片機I2C串行總線數據傳送模擬

又有面向字符和麪向比特以及面向字節計數三種。其中,面向字節計數的同步協議主要用於DEC公司的網絡體系....
發表於 2021-01-15 10:38 113次閲讀
單片機I2C串行總線數據傳送模擬

基於STM32F103C8單片機的鐵路車輛無線軸温報警儀設計

針對現有鐵路車輛軸温探測系統(THDS)存在温度檢測盲區、實時性差、故障點指示效率低等不足,設計了一款鐵路車輛無...
發表於 2021-01-15 10:03 101次閲讀
基於STM32F103C8單片機的鐵路車輛無線軸温報警儀設計

單片機IO口如何控制兩顆LED?

  將兩顆LED命名為D1、D2,兩顆LED就會有如下4種組合:D1和D2都熄滅-D1亮D2滅-D1滅D2亮-D1和D2都亮...
發表於 2021-01-14 17:01 0次閲讀
單片機IO口如何控制兩顆LED?

單片機如何區別按鍵長按和短按?

  單片機工程師在面試的過程中,經常會碰到一些相同的問題,筆者總結了十個提問率較高的問題,供大家參考。現在我們...
發表於 2021-01-14 16:59 0次閲讀
單片機如何區別按鍵長按和短按?

單片機IIC通訊實例

  IIC通訊在單片機開發中是比較常見的一種通訊協議,也有很多網友對其進行了詳細分析,但是作者發現網友大多是對...
發表於 2021-01-14 16:56 0次閲讀
單片機IIC通訊實例

電源基本知識:電源的基本工作原理是什麼?

開關電路的原理是由開關管和PWM(Pulse Width Modulation)控制芯片構成振盪電路....
發表於 2021-01-14 15:08 217次閲讀
電源基本知識:電源的基本工作原理是什麼?

集成電路的多種實現方式

微電子技術的發展,使微電子設備的能耗得到了極大地降低,從而開始進入了工業應用。傳統的微電子技術大致可....
發表於 2021-01-14 14:18 208次閲讀
集成電路的多種實現方式

為什麼有經驗的工程師會更喜歡用11.0592M晶...

  晶振是單片機工作所必不可缺少的元器件,晶振的種類眾多,該如何選擇合適的晶振呢? 在用51單片機設....
發表於 2021-01-13 16:18 211次閲讀
為什麼有經驗的工程師會更喜歡用11.0592M晶...

STM32價格瘋長下,盤點STM32的國產替代者...

2020.10.28的時候,我登陸立創商城,搜索stm32f103c8t6,單價15左右,100片的....
發表於 2021-01-13 16:15 598次閲讀
STM32價格瘋長下,盤點STM32的國產替代者...

可靠的電源管理技術

TI高壓電源解決方案副總裁Steve Lambouses表示:“我們的客户正在尋找在不大幅增加車輛重....
發表於 2021-01-13 14:00 156次閲讀
可靠的電源管理技術

利用TMS320F28x數字信號控制器提高太陽能...

對於那些能源無法自給的國家,太陽能和其他替代能源擁有無可爭議的優勢,可幫助他們達到減少化石燃料消耗和....
發表於 2021-01-13 09:44 247次閲讀
利用TMS320F28x數字信號控制器提高太陽能...

鐵電存儲器在多MCU系統中應用(附fm24c16...

1、鐵電存儲器技術原理、特性及應用 美國Ramtron公司鐵電存儲器(FRAM)的核心技術是鐵電晶體....
發表於 2021-01-13 05:24 177次閲讀
鐵電存儲器在多MCU系統中應用(附fm24c16...

單片機模擬銀行自動取款機仿真設計方案

注意:這個是proteus仿真設計,電路是proteus仿真電路。 主要功能: 1、可以實現取款、查....
發表於 2021-01-12 13:41 239次閲讀
單片機模擬銀行自動取款機仿真設計方案

基於單片機的聲源定位設計方案

本設計是基於單片機的聲源定位設計,除了可以實現基本的聲源定位,聲源方位顯示外,還能語音播報方位,實用....
發表於 2021-01-12 11:53 200次閲讀
基於單片機的聲源定位設計方案

基於CH375S和STC89C516RD單片機實...

隨着移動數據存儲領域的日益擴大,在嵌入式系統中實現USB主機功能,以實現利用USB存儲設備進行數據存....
發表於 2021-01-12 10:31 542次閲讀
基於CH375S和STC89C516RD單片機實...

基於CPLD芯片和C8051F020實現聲探測系...

被動聲源探測定位技術是一種利用聲學傳聲器陣列和電子裝置接收運動目標的輻射噪聲,以確定目標所處位置的技....
發表於 2021-01-12 09:46 184次閲讀
基於CPLD芯片和C8051F020實現聲探測系...